RSS DEV-Gemeinschaft

UUIDs mit JavaScript Generatoren erzeugen

UUIDs, oder Globally Unique Identifiers (weltweit eindeutige Kennungen), sind 128-Bit-Etiketten, die Ressourcen mit hoher Wahrscheinlichkeit eindeutig identifizieren. Sie kommen in verschiedenen Formaten vor, wobei das gebräuchlichste eine Zeichenkette aus 32 hexadezimalen Ziffern ist, die durch Bindestriche getrennt sind. UUIDs haben fünf Versionen und vier Varianten, die durch RFC 4122 definiert sind. JavaScript-Generatoren sind spezielle Funktionen, die mehrere Werte zurückgeben und die Codeausführung anhalten können. Sie können in Kombination mit dem `yield`-Operator verwendet werden, um eine Endlosschleife zu erstellen und eine Zahl kontinuierlich zu inkrementieren. Um UUIDs in JavaScript mithilfe von Generatoren zu erzeugen, erstellen Sie eine Generatorfunktion, die eine Hilfsfunktion aufruft, um eine UUID basierend auf einem bestimmten Muster zu erzeugen. Die Generatorfunktion liefert die generierten UUIDs endlos, und Sie können den Zeichenkettenwert extrahieren, indem Sie auf die `value`-Eigenschaft des zurückgegebenen Objekts zugreifen. Die Kombination aus der innovativen Verwendung von JavaScript-Generatoren und der UUID-Generierungsfunktion ermöglicht einen Front-End-basierten UUID-Generator. Dieser Prozess gewährleistet Datenintegrität und vermeidet Konflikte, indem er eindeutige Kennungen für Anwendungen bereitstellt. Indem Sie die im Artikel beschriebenen Schritte befolgen, können Sie eindeutige Kennungen für Ihre JavaScript-Anwendungen mithilfe von Generatorfunktionen erstellen. Die UUID-Generierung in JavaScript mithilfe von Generatorfunktionen ist eine einfache und zuverlässige Methode zur Verwaltung eindeutiger Dateneinträge. Wenn Sie fortgeschrittenere JavaScript-Techniken erkunden möchten, sollten Sie das Buch "Concise JavaScript: For Beginners and Advanced Learners" in Betracht ziehen.
favicon
dev.to
Generating UUIDs with JavaScript Generators
Create attached notes ...